The campaign of Donald Trump, presumptive presidential nominee of the Republican party, has set a target of raising another $10 million by the month end, according to an email sent on Monday.
Over the last few days, the Trump campaign raised $11 million, it said adding it is working to "shatter records" by raising another $10 million in the remaining four days of June.
The mass email seeking funds was sent by his son Eric Trump, who described it as the most ambitious fund raising campaign yet.
"Hillary Clinton's campaign machine and her liberal media allies are desperate. First, they claimed we raised too little. Then, when donors like you helped us to raise $11 million in just a few days, they claimed we were lying," the junior Trump wrote in his first fund raising email.
A real estate tycoon from New York, Donald Trump had self-funded his campaign during the primary elections. He started raising money for the general election in May.
In May, Clinton out-raised him. However, Trump argues that he started fund raising only in the last few days of May.
The Trump campaign says its fund raising activities have gained pace this month.
"The truth is we did better than $11 million and no amount of spin from Crooked Hillary's machine can change that fact. We cannot let them get away with this," Eric Trump said.
"That's why we set another Trump-sized goal. We are working to shatter records again this week — by raising another $10 million before the Federal Election Commission's 2nd quarter fund raising deadline this Thursday at midnight.
